What is the meaning of the prefix hypo- as used in medical terms?

Explanation:
Hypo- denotes below normal or deficient in medical terms. It signals that a value or function is reduced. For example, hypoglycemia means blood sugar is below normal, hypothermia means body temperature is below normal, and hypotension means blood pressure is below normal. This prefix sits opposite hyper-, which means above normal. It doesn’t convey ideas like between or around, which would use different prefixes. So the meaning of the prefix in medical terms is indeed below normal.
